Signs of Cold Stress in Dwarf morning glory
Symptoms
Dwarf morning glory tolerates cool conditions moderately well and flourishes optimally when temperatures exceed 60℉. In winter, maintain temperatures above 45℉. If the temperature drops below 32℉, foliage may begin to sag. Minor cases can recover, but severe instances lead to wilting and eventual leaf drop.
Solutions
Remove any parts damaged by frost. Before subsequent cold exposure, cover the plant with materials like non-woven fabric or cloth, and build a windbreak to shield it from cold gusts.
Signs of Heat Stress in Dwarf morning glory
Symptoms
In summer, Dwarf morning glory should be maintained below 75℉. When temperatures surpass 85℉, leaf coloration fades, leaf tips may dry and shrivel, leaves might curl, and the plant becomes more prone to sunburn.
Solutions
Prune off any sun-scorched and desiccated sections. Relocate the plant to a spot offering protection from the midday and afternoon sun, or use a shade net to provide cover. Water the plant in the morning and evening to ensure soil moisture.
